Valdosta doctor in federal court

VALDOSTA — A Lowndes County physician is in federal court this week on charges of health-care fraud, according to court documents.

Dr. Douglas Moss and physician's assistant Shawn Tywon were indicted by a federal grand jury May 8, 2018, on six counts of health-care fraud and one count of conspiracy to commit health-care fraud.

Tywon agreed to a plea deal April 1, pleading guilty to the conspiracy count. He faces up to a $250,000 fine and 10 years in prison, according to the plea deal.

Moss' trial began Monday.

The indictment accuses Moss and Tywon of trying to defraud Medicare and Medicaid programs by submitting false claims for services at local nursing homes that they never provided.

In 2011, Moss accepted positions as medical director for Holly Hill Nursing Home, Valdosta Nursing Home, Lakehaven Nursing Home and Crestwood Nursing Home, court documents state. According to the Georgia Composite Medical Board's website, Moss' specialty is emergency medicine and he received his Georgia medical license in 1995.

From January 2012 through December 2014, Moss, Tywon and "co-conspirators, both known and unknown to the Grand Jury" submitted more than 31,000 claims for nursing home care to Medicare and Georgia Medicaid, according to the indictment.

Both defendants knew that many of these services were not rendered by Moss and were not medically necessary, the indictment claims.

Among the claims made by the indictment:

• Records showed one patient was known to be asleep when a supposed doctor's visit occurred.

• There were at least 100 separate times when Moss' practice claimed he saw more than 100 nursing home patients in a single day.

• In February 2014, there were 85 billed nursing home visits supposedly made by Moss, even though travel records show he was in Las Vegas at the time.

The indictment calls for forfeiture of assets in the event of a conviction.
